The Buffalo Bills have just wrapped up their mandatory minicamp, marking the beginning of the quietest period in the NFL calendar as fans eagerly await training camp in late July. This downtime is essential for players, coaches, and fans alike, as it allows everyone to recharge before the intensity of the upcoming season. With no news being good news, Bills supporters are hoping for a smooth offseason free from injuries or off-field issues, reminiscent of the unfortunate incident involving Nyheim Hines a few years back. Looking ahead, there is much for Bills fans to anticipate as the team prepares to return to St. John Fisher University for training camp, celebrating 25 years at this beloved location. The excitement will build as fans look forward to highlights from undrafted free agents and updates on the projected 53-man roster. As the preseason approaches, Bills Mafia will be eager to witness their team in action at the new Highmark Stadium, marking a fresh chapter in their football journey. The anticipation for the first preseason game is palpable, and while it may come with its own set of nerves, it promises to be a thrilling experience for fans. As the offseason progresses, the focus will shift to training camp battles and player performances, keeping the spirit of the Buffalo Bills alive and well until the regular season kicks off.
